Study of dielectric relaxation and dipole moment of some hydrogen bonded solvent binary mixtures in 1,4-dioxane

Abstract

943-952The dielectric relaxation and dipole moment of different concentration binary mixtures of mono methyl, mono ethyl and mono butyl ethers of ethylene glycol with four polar solvents i.e. ethyl alcohol, glycerol, dimethyl sulphoxide and dimethyl formamide have been measured in dilute solutions of 1,4-dioxane at 35°C. The measured values of permittivity (') and dielectric loss ('') at 10.1 GHz, static dielectric constant (o) at 1 MHz and high frequency limiting dielectric constant (∞) have been used to determine the values of molecular relaxation time ( o), and dipole moment ( ) of the different composition binary mixtures. The analysis of the results based on hetero-association in these binary systems, indicates the existence of different characteristic heterogeneous species in dilute solutions. The comparative values of o and of the various binary mixtures of different composition also suggest that the nature of heterogeneous interaction varies with the type of polar solvent and also constituents composition in the binary mixture
